Hi, I’m Olivia Walke,, an Associate Marriage and Family Therapist with Find Your Balance Center for Growth & Change. I work with children, teens, and adults navigating anxiety, depression, trauma, life transitions, and emotional challenges. Many clients come to therapy feeling overwhelmed, disconnected, or struggling to make sense of their experiences. My goal is to provide a supportive, compassionate space where you can process your story, build insight, and begin moving toward healing, resilience, and meaningful growth.

 

My work focuses on helping you process trauma and regulate emotions using Trauma-Focused CBT (TF-CBT) and DBT-informed skills. I support clients in building coping strategies, increasing emotional stability, and gradually facing fears in a way that feels manageable and empowering.

 

I have experience supporting individuals with anxiety disorders, including social anxiety, panic, and phobias, as well as those navigating depression and high-risk behaviors. Therapy is a space to rebuild a sense of control and reconnect with yourself. Together, we work toward creating stability, confidence, and a stronger sense of direction.

If you are considering psychotherapy but do not know where to start, a free initial consultation is the perfect first step. It will allow you to explore your options, ask questions, and feel more confident about taking the first step towards your well-being.

It is a 30-minute, completely free meeting with a Mental Health specialist that does not obligate you to anything.
